For over fifty years Eliot Weinberger has been celebrated for his innovative literary and political essaysātranslated into over thirty languagesāas well as his trailblazing translations from the Spanish. In his exquisite new book
The Life of Tu Fu, Weinberger has composed a montage of fifty-eight poems that capture the life and times of the great Tang Dynasty poet Tu Fu (712ā770 AD). As he writes in a note to the edition, āThis is not a translation of individual poems, but a fictional autobiography of Tu Fu derived and adapted from the thoughts, images, and allusions in the poetry.ā Through lines as penetrating as a classical tanka and as fluid as a mountain stream, themes of endless war and ongoing pandemic surround the wandering life of the ancient Chinese master.
